Railroads - Unions - General

 File — Box: 10, Folder: 12

Scope and Contents

"The Brotherhood of Railway Trainmen," unsigned typescript ("paid 10-7-53"), 5 pages; two page description by black employee of the Panama Canal / Panama Railroad Co. re efforts of "two white organizers" from the United Brotherhood of Maintenance of Way and Railway Shop Laborers to organize black workers; includes description of resistance by white labor unions, response of AFL, and successful result, unsigned, May 22, 1919; much correspondence between AFL President Gompers and officials of various rail unions, 1918-21; "Remarks of Samuel Gompers Before Conference of the Executives of the Railroad Organizations Affiliated with the AFL and the Four Brotherhoods," February 10, 1920, 17 pages; notes
